The 7-Step Tennessee LLC Formation Process
Every Tennessee LLC follows the same core process. Here is exactly what happens, in order, and what Gullia Filing handles on your behalf.
Choose a Tennessee LLC name
Pick a name that includes "LLC", "L.L.C.", or "Limited Liability Company" and is distinguishable from existing Tennessee entities. Our free name check tool verifies availability against the Tennessee Secretary of State database in seconds.
Appoint a Tennessee registered agent
Tennessee requires a registered agent with a physical street address in the state to receive legal and tax notices. Gullia Filing provides this service in every package, protecting your privacy and ensuring you never miss a critical filing.
File the Articles of Organization
Submit formation paperwork to the Tennessee Secretary of State with a $300 filing fee. The state does not offer expedited processing. We handle the filing electronically and forward your certified copy within 3-5 business days.
Obtain your EIN (Federal Tax ID)
Apply to the IRS for an Employer Identification Number, required to open a US business bank account, hire employees, and file federal taxes. Included free in every Gullia Filing package.
Draft an operating agreement
An operating agreement establishes member rights, profit distributions, management structure, and dispute resolution. Even single-member LLCs benefit from having one on file for bank account opening and to reinforce the corporate veil. We provide a state-compliant, attorney-reviewed template in every package.
Register for Tennessee taxes and licenses
Register with the Tennessee Department of Revenue for state tax IDs, sales tax permits if applicable, and any industry-specific licenses. Our compliance calendar tracks every deadline automatically.

Tennessee LLC Tax Obligations
State tax summary
No state personal income tax on wages. Franchise & Excise Tax applies to LLCs: $100 minimum franchise + 6.5% on net earnings.
Franchise tax: $100 minimum franchise tax + $100 excise tax (based on net earnings 6.5%). Applies to all LLCs regardless of income.
Federal tax defaults
A single-member Tennessee LLC is treated as a disregarded entity federally (income flows to Schedule C or E of the owner's Form 1040). A multi-member LLC defaults to partnership taxation (Form 1065). You may elect S-Corp status (Form 2553) or C-Corp status (Form 8832) if it reduces overall tax.
